Cat mom here ??‍♀️.... Yesterday, in response to our story, I was asked by numerous people how I got Monk. So, I decided to share in a post for any new friends who don’t know the back story of Monk. (WARNING: LONG POST) ??⤵️ . In 2006, my Dad died of brain cancer. A few months later a close friend of mine died in a plane crash. A year after that I had a horrible car wreck that left me with a broken back. I was in the thick of grief and drowning in depression. I was also in pain management for my back injury and was receiving procedures regularly (epidurals, nerve blocks, radiofrequency... yada yada). ?? . On September 29th 2010, while on my way home from one of my many procedures, a tiny black kitten darted in front of the car. My mother was driving and I was still groggy from being under anesthesia that day. We pulled over, got out and found that the tiny kitten ran underneath the car. He was skin and bones. His eyes were infected and sealed shut with crust. He was covered in filth and bugs. Without hesitation we put him in the car and brought him home. I estimated him to be about 4-6 weeks old. He was bathed, fed and taken to the vet the next day. At first I was planning to find him a home, but as each day passed I realized he was sent to me. It was a #divinealignment. He helped heal my heart. ♥️ . Originally Monk was named Sergio, after the Surgi-center where I was coming from the day I found him. However, as he grew healthier and stronger his personality started to flourish. He was CRAZY. He climbed everything and swung from all the things. His energy, curiosity and mischievousness was endless. So his name was quickly changed to Monkey, Monk for short. ? . To answer another common question, Monk was not born with fangs. When I rescued him he did NOT have those ferocious pearlies. In fact, he was missing some teeth due to malnourishment. It wasn’t until he was around one year old that he became a silky #vampirecat ??‍♀️ . I think it’s important to share stories like this to show just how powerful the love of an animal/animals is.
